Stacy A. Brown has served as President of the Shreveport-Bossier Convention and Tourist Bureau for 20 years and has more than 35 years of experience in the travel and tourism industry. She joined the bureau as Vice President of Communications. A division of the bureau, the Boom or Bust Byway is flourishing under Stacy’s direction, bringing new visitation to the rural areas.
Under her leadership, the bureau has received zero exception audits and has become accredited under Destinations International’s Destination Marketing Accreditation Program. In 2019 the four-year renewal was received after successfully complying with 58 mandatory and 30 voluntary standards.
She has earned her Certified Destination Management Executive from the Destinations International. She currently serves on a number of boards including the National Scenic Byway Foundation, the Louisiana Association of Convention & Visitor Bureaus, as well as local boards. Stacy was chosen as one of “5 Over 50” by Biz Magazine in 2015 and presented the Athena Award in 2006.
She has been a guest speaker for national, state and local tourism conferences.
Stacy is a graduate of Stephen F. Austin State University. She has served as a mentor for high school and university students in the communications, journalism and marketing fields. An active member in her church, Stacy has taught Sunday school and served as a leader for Awanas.
